Sherry now resides at 1998 Landmark Dr #505, Indianapolis, In 46260. Sherry has previously lived in Indianapolis, Champaign and Urbana. Sherry turned 57 years old. Her birth year was listed as 1968. The number currently linked to Sherry is (317) 293-2613. Records link Sherry with Jerry D Mccullum, Dan J Strong, Dan Mccullum and 2 other people.